π« Common Mistake:
βI am good in English.β
β
Correct:
βI am good at English.β
π Why?
We use good at when talking about skills or abilities.
β
Examples:
β’ Iβm good at English.
β’ Sheβs good at speaking.
β’ Theyβre good at math.

Your or Youβre?
Donβt Mix Them Up!
β Your welcome!
β
Youβre welcome!
π‘ Remember: "Your" shows possession:
Your bag ποΈ
Your car π
Your house π
** While "Youβre" = You are.
You're smart
You're happy
You're tall
